Scorpio Tankers Inc. (NYSE:STNG – Get Free Report) has received a consensus rating of “Hold” from the five research firms that are presently covering the stock, MarketBeat Ratings reports. Three investment analysts have rated the stock with a hold recommendation and two have given a buy recommendation to the company. The average twelve-month price objective among analysts that have issued ratings on the stock in the last year is $72.75.
A number of brokerages have recently weighed in on STNG. Bank of America lowered their price target on Scorpio Tankers from $73.00 to $71.00 and set a “neutral” rating on the stock in a report on Tuesday, October 22nd. Evercore ISI lowered their price target on Scorpio Tankers from $84.00 to $80.00 and set an “outperform” rating on the stock in a report on Wednesday, October 30th. Jefferies Financial Group reduced their price objective on Scorpio Tankers from $80.00 to $75.00 and set a “buy” rating for the company in a research report on Thursday, December 12th. Finally, Stifel Nicolaus cut Scorpio Tankers from a “buy” rating to a “hold” rating and reduced their price objective for the company from $90.00 to $65.00 in a research report on Wednesday, October 23rd.

Scorpio Tankers Stock Performance
Shares of NYSE STNG opened at $47.81 on Monday. The company has a quick ratio of 2.18, a current ratio of 2.21 and a debt-to-equity ratio of 0.27. The stock has a market capitalization of $2.42 billion, a price-to-earnings ratio of 3.43 and a beta of 0.12. The stock’s fifty day simple moving average is $49.91 and its 200 day simple moving average is $61.42. Scorpio Tankers has a 52-week low of $45.43 and a 52-week high of $84.67.
About Scorpio Tankers
Scorpio Tankers Inc, together with its subsidiaries, engages in the seaborne transportation of crude oi and refined petroleum products in the shipping markets worldwide. As of March 21, 2024, its fleet consisted of 110 owned and leases financed tanker, including 39 LR2, 57 MR, and 14 Handymax with a weighted average age of approximately 8.1 years.
